Characters: Cyclops- the field leader of the X-Men, with the power to emit optic blasts that are incredibly powerful. Jean Grey- the red-headed telepath and telekinetic who is a core member of the X-Men. Rogue- member of the X-Men who can drain powers with a single touch. Shadowcat- a younger, peppy member of the X-Men, Shadowcat can pass through solid objects. Nightcrawler- a fuzzy mutant in the X-Men who is an acrobat and can teleport. Storm- an elder member of the X-Men who can control the weather. Wolverine- an elder member of the X-Men with razor claws and healing properties. Xavier- the X-Men's professor, and a master telepath. Beast- a blue and fuzzy acrobatic mutant in the X-Men. Spyke- once in the X-Men, now in the Morlocks with bony-plate natural body armor. Boom-Boom- a rebellious New Mutant who was once in the Brotherhood. She has explosive powers. Multiple- a young New Mutant who can multiply his body. Magma- a New Mutant with fire powers. Berzerker- a New Mutant who can channel the elements. Sunspot- a New Mutant who can use the sun's power to become super-strong. Iceman- the leader of the New Mutants, Iceman can alter temperatures and create cold. Havok- Cyclops' lost brother, Havok can fire energy from his hands. Angel- quite wealthy, he has helped the X-Men before, but isn't on the team. He has wings. Magneto- leader of the Acolytes, Magneto has magnetic powers. Sabertooth- member of the Acolytes with ferocious skills and fighting powers. Gambit- member of the Acolytes with kinetic charging energies. Pyro- member of the Acolytes who can control flame. Colossus- member of the Acolytes who has a metal body covering. Mesmero- a mind-controlling villain who serves the evil Apocalypse. Agatha- member of the Acolytes with mind-warping and mind-reading abilities. Pietro- a speedster, and member of the Brotherhood with ties to the Acolytes. Wanda- daughter of Magneto, now in the Brotherhood with hex powers. Avalanche- member of the Brotherhood, in the X-Men for a short time. He can create earthquakes. Blob- member of the Brotherhood, incredibly large with great strength. Toad- member of the Brotherhood. Acrobatic with a long tongue. Mystique- leader of the Brotherhood, a shapeshifter with blue skin. Nick Fury- leader of Shield. Nick Fury is a government agent. Trask- creator of the Sentinel program. In jail for attacking mutants. Leech- a young mutant boy who can halt energy flow. Apocalypse- ancient Egyptian evil, now released and walking the Earth.

Magneto attempts to track down and destroy Apocalypse. However, Xavier isn't so keen to follow that example, and focuses elsewhere. Mystique, still a statue, is given to the Brotherhood for safekeeping. Nightcrawler, however, wants to bring his mom's statue body back to the Institute, and does so, much to Rogue's objections. Jean discovers that Apocalypse is currently in Mexico. Xavier, Cyclops, Jean, Shadowcat, Beast and Wolverine go there and attempt to peacefully communicate with Apocalypse, in the hope that they can arrange a peaceful truce. Unfortunately, Magneto attacks Apocalypse. The two battle, and Apocalypse kills Magneto with ease. Back in Bayville, Nightcrawler contacts Agatha. Rogue discovers that the two are meeting, and is quite angry about it. Agatha says that only Rogue can save Mystique from her fate as a statue. Nightcrawler begs Rogue to do the right thing, but Rogue, in a rage, pushes the Mystique statue off a cliff. Before Nightcrawler can save her, Mystique's statue body shatters. Apocalypse continues moving around the world, and he creates a second sphere in China. The military attempts to destroy it, but fails to do so. With little alternatives left, Nick Fury is ordered to free Trask and have him bring back the Sentinel program for the United States government to use against Apocalypse. Some time later, a new sphere appears in Eygpt. Xavier wants to try one more time to communicate peacefully with Apocalypse, and brings Storm with him. The other X-Men are able to watch via Cerebro's technology. During the discussion between Xavier and Apocalypse, the Egyptian villain informs the good professor that he plans to awaken the X-Gene in all humans over the world, turning them into mutants—that is, if they survive, which most will not. Xavier tries to talk Apocalypse out of this, but Apocalypse grows angry and prepares to attack. Storm, however, refuses to let anyone harm the professor, and attacks Apocalypse, throwing lightning at him. Apocalypse laughs at this attempt, and kills both of them as the other X- Men watch, horrified. Nick Fury soon comes to the Institute to inform them that Trask has restarted the Sentinel program to stop Apocalypse. Three Sentinels attack Apocalypse at the Sphinx, but he easily dispatches them. However, they served only as a decoy—other Sentinels were being sent to the three spheres to destroy them. To protect the spheres and the Sphinx, Apocalypse calls to his four Horsemen. The X-Men are startled to reveal the identities of these warriors. Magneto, the Horseman of War; Storm, the Horseman of Famine; Mystique, the Horseman of Pestilence; and Xavier, the Horseman of Death. Apocalypse hadn't killed them after all, but had merely possessed them and given them greater powers. Magneto was sent to protect the sphere in Mexico, Storm was sent to protect the sphere in China, and Xavier was sent to protect the sphere in Egypt. Mystique remained to guard the Sphinx. At first, it seemed like the Sentinels would succeed. The brought down the barriers on the spheres. However, the Horsemen, with their heightened powers, absolutely destroyed the Sentinels. Nick Fury had no choice left but to entrust the X-Men with the job of stopping Apocalypse. Wolverine took charge, and had the X-Men gather the Brotherhood, the Morlocks and the New Mutants, as well as anyone else they could find. He also stated that he had a special job for Rogue to do. The X-Men and their new recruits split into four groups. Wolverine, Cyclops and Nightcrawler went to the Sphinx. Jean Grey, Boom-Boom, Colossus, Multiple and Magma were sent to Egypt. Beast, Berzerker, Iceman and Spyke were sent to China. Finally, Shadowcat, Sunspot, Angel, Havok and Wanda were sent to Mexico. The four teams prepared for battle... And they were losing. Apocalypse prepared for the next step, and sent his pyramids into the skies above Earth. They pyramids formed an energy web, preparing to turn all humans into mutants and kill the rest. The X-Men become desperate, and the Brotherhood comes to battle Magneto in order to help Wanda. Jean, seeing the rest of her team fall, uses the power of Cerebro to enhance her psychic powers, and proceeds to battle Xavier on the astral plane. Her spirit power took the shape of a Phoenix, and she was able to strike him down. Unfortunately, Apocalypse is not stopped. He lies down in his original resting place to prepare for the evolution of mankind. Just when all seems lost, though, Nick Fury brings Rogue into the scene. Rogue had absorbed the powers of Leech, a young boy who could shut down any kind of energy—mutant, electrical, or anything else. She gets to Apocalypse's chamber, and shuts down all of his powers, sealing him away once again and stopping his plans. He is sent to another time period, and the Horsemen are brought out from the possession. Xavier, in his battle with Jean, had seen images...and the most disturbing of all, was Jean, brimming with Phoenix power, becoming their greatest enemy.
